Zusammenfassung |
The characterization of an heterogeneous geological media can be approached by means of an statistical treatment of the field data. This lets us know its spatial variability behaviour, in probability terms. The algorithms presented in this work belongs to the scope of simulation of geological heterogeneous random fields. The aim of that characterization is related with the reseach studies of nuclear waste repositories in deep geological structures. Several stochastic generation algorithms are presented, based in the geostatistical regionalized variable, fractal geometry, and spectral Fourier theories. Some of them are deeply exposed here to their understanding. As a result of the paper, some comparative schemes are showed with numerical, geostatistical and spectral analysis of the implicit autorregresive generation methods. |

Zusammenfassung |
Standard 0-group indices and distribution maps are now produced based on hand-drawn maps using AutoCad with some additional procedures. This paper briefly describes the method. The paper further describes ways of importing coastlines and survey data directly into standard computer programs such as AutoCad and SAS. Standard methods are used for gridding data, producing isolines and further calculation of abundance indices and presentation of distributions. Interactive editing of distribution maps are made, which makes corresponding automatic updating of indices possible. |

Zusammenfassung |
Because of the simplicity of calculation and the availability of evaluating the precision of the estimates, a partial likelihood approach has been used for estimating fish mortality rates from tag recoveries and the stock composition in the mixed population based on genetic data. We compare the partial likelihood estimator with the full likelihood estimator, and find that under some conditions, both estimators are the same. The above applications meet the conditions and hence the estimates using the partial likelihood are the same as the ones using the full likelihood. In this case, the partial likelihood approach is quite useful. |

Zusammenfassung |
As the CoastWatch regional node for the Great Lakes, the Great Lakes Environmental Research Laboratory (GLERL) is working to obtain and/or develop and deliver environmental data and products for near real-time monitoring of the Great Lakes to support environmental science and decision making. In support of this goal, GLERL is providing access to near real-time and retrospective satellite observations and in-situ data for the Great Lakes to Federal, state, and local agencies and academic institutions. There are currently nearly 40 regional CoastWatch users. The goals and objectives of the Great Lakes CoastWatch Program directly support agency statutory responsibilities in estuarine and marine science, living marine resource protection, and ecosystem monitoring and management. GLERL is currently receiving an enhanced digital image product suite of 26 images including satellite derived surface-temperature, visible and near-infrared reflectance, brightness temperatures, satellite and solar zenith angle data, and cloud masks from the NOAA-12 satellite. These products are downloaded from the NOAA Ocean Products Center (OPC) via INTERNET on a daily basis and archived at GLERL. Over 32,000 image products have been received and archived since becoming the Great Lakes CoastWatch Node in 1990. GOES-8 data is also currently being received. |

Zusammenfassung |
A simple analytical technique is developed for estimating the predictability of recruitment, that is, correlations between recruitment and stage-specific mortalities or abundances. The method requires the input of estimates of the variability of stage-specific mortalities, which may be calculated from mean stage-specific mortalities by applying a published regression. It is shown that modification of this regression to compensate for sampling error in field measurements of abundance significantly reduces the estimated standard deviation of log-recruitment, which is an important factor in the predictability calculations. It is concluded that the prospects for predicting recruitment from egg or larval surveys or from environmental variables are quite poor for fish stocks showing the typical distribution of mortality across stages. |

Zusammenfassung |
Several new models are developed to estimate the velocity and diffusion of a population from tagging data. The new estimators apply the inverse principle to the individual trajectories of recovered tags rather than to their local abundance. These models require fewer assumptions and less information than do published abundance-based methods. Techniques are presented for a variety of circumstances, and both discrete and continuous parameterizations of the velocity field are included. The sensitivity of the estimators to violations of the assumptions was examined numerically by using stochastic simulations. The results suggest that the estimators are fairly robust but may fail under certain conditions. Extensions to accommodate these situations are discussed. |

Zusammenfassung |
Sea surface height may be measured by a satellite-borne altimeter and its along-track slope used to infer geostrophic currents. A major difficulty is that, in general, the local geoid and satellite orbit are not known to the accuracy desired. Thus, comparison is often made between repeat flights of an altimeter along fixed ground tracks in order to infer the changes in the currents. In practice, it is convenient to calculate a mean height profile from many repeat passes and use this as a reference, so that individual altimetric profiles yield variations about this mean. It is thus important to derive a high-quality reliable estimate of the altimetric mean in order to minimize the errors in the inferred flows for the individual repeats. This work examines various methods for deriving the mean profile. |

Zusammenfassung |
Often only simple relative abundance time series and basic growth and (or) survival estimates are available for assessing impacts of fishing and environmental factors. Assessment then involves fitting production models to the series, while forcing the model with observed catch or effort series. A key uncertainty in this approach is how to deal with recruitment variations due to factors other than stock size. A dynamic programming algorithm can be used to compute maximum likelihood estimates of the recruitment anomaly sequence, given prior knowledge of growth parameters, the natural survival rate, and proportion of the variation in the relative abundance index that is due to abundance measurement errors. |

Zusammenfassung |
The authors sampled fishes and measured microhabitat in series of contiguous habitat units (riffles, runs, pools) in three Virginia streams. Monte Carlo simulations were used to construct hypothetical series of habitat units, then examined how number of species, similarity in relative abundances, and number of microhabitats accumulated with increasing number of habitat units (i.e., sampling effort). The curves indicated that 90% of the species present were usually found by sampling 5 to 14 habitat units (stream length of 22-67 stream widths). Estimates of species relative abundances required less sampling effort for a given accuracy than estimates of number of species. Rates of species accumulation (with effort) varied among streams and reflected discontinuity in species distributions among habitat units. Most discontinuity seemed to be due to low population density rather than to habitat selectivity. Results from an Illinois stream corroborated our findings from Virginia, and suggested that greater sampling effort is needed to characterize fish community structure in more homogeneous stream reaches. |
